Tīmeklis2024. gada 4. febr. · The problem of finding the best lower bound: is called the dual problem associated with the Lagrangian defined above. It optimal value is the dual optimal value. As noted above, is concave. This means that the dual problem, which involves the maximization of with sign constraints on the variables, is a convex … Tīmeklis2024. gada 18. sept. · Combining Deep Learning and Lagrangian Dual Methods. Tīmeklisthe optimal solution of the Lagrangian dual coincides with the optimal solution of the initial problem. Also, the bound obtained thanks to the Lagrangian relaxation is at least as good as the one obtained from fractional relaxation. 12.2.1 Lagrangian dual Consider the following integer linear programme: Minimize cTx subject to Ax=b x∈X …
